29#ifndef _OPENSOLARIS_SYS_RWLOCK_H_
30#define	_OPENSOLARIS_SYS_RWLOCK_H_
31
32#include <sys/param.h>
33#include <sys/proc.h>
34#include <sys/lock.h>
35#include <sys/sx.h>
36
37typedef enum {
38	RW_DEFAULT = 4		/* kernel default rwlock */
39} krw_type_t;
40
41
42typedef enum {
43	RW_NONE		= 0,
44	RW_WRITER	= 1,
45	RW_READER	= 2
46} krw_t;
47
48typedef	struct sx	krwlock_t;
49
50#ifndef OPENSOLARIS_WITNESS
51#define	RW_FLAGS	(SX_DUPOK | SX_NEW | SX_NOWITNESS)
52#else
53#define	RW_FLAGS	(SX_DUPOK | SX_NEW)
54#endif
55
56#define	RW_READ_HELD(x)		(rw_read_held((x)))
57#define	RW_WRITE_HELD(x)	(rw_write_held((x)))
58#define	RW_LOCK_HELD(x)		(rw_lock_held((x)))
59#define	RW_ISWRITER(x)		(rw_iswriter(x))
60#define	rw_init(lock, desc, type, arg)	do {				\
61	const char *_name;						\
62	ASSERT((type) == 0 || (type) == RW_DEFAULT);			\
63	for (_name = #lock; *_name != '\0'; _name++) {			\
64		if (*_name >= 'a' && *_name <= 'z')			\
65			break;						\
66	}								\
67	if (*_name == '\0')						\
68		_name = #lock;						\
69	sx_init_flags((lock), _name, RW_FLAGS);				\
70} while (0)
71#define	rw_destroy(lock)	sx_destroy(lock)
72#define	rw_enter(lock, how)	do {					\
73	if ((how) == RW_READER)						\
74		sx_slock(lock);						\
75	else /* if ((how) == RW_WRITER) */				\
76		sx_xlock(lock);						\
77	} while (0)
78
79#define	rw_tryenter(lock, how)			   \
80	((how) == RW_READER ? sx_try_slock(lock) : sx_try_xlock(lock))
81#define	rw_exit(lock)		sx_unlock(lock)
82#define	rw_downgrade(lock)	sx_downgrade(lock)
83#define	rw_tryupgrade(lock)	sx_try_upgrade(lock)
84#define	rw_read_held(lock)					  \
85	((lock)->sx_lock != SX_LOCK_UNLOCKED &&	  \
86	    ((lock)->sx_lock & SX_LOCK_SHARED))
87#define	rw_write_held(lock)	sx_xlocked(lock)
88#define	rw_lock_held(lock)	(rw_read_held(lock) || rw_write_held(lock))
89#define	rw_iswriter(lock)	sx_xlocked(lock)
90#define	rw_owner(lock)		sx_xholder(lock)
91
92#endif	/* _OPENSOLARIS_SYS_RWLOCK_H_ */
